Transaction 2f4c11c858f3080d307eac40a105135bf79948e581c4e83e6519fac39f33cb33

40 Input
1 Outputs
  • 2f4c11c858f3080d307eac40a105135bf79948e581c4e83e6519fac39f33cb33:0
  • value  4562171
    address  3R1qpu7fn4jByobGafWCrUKtWqY7rtVb5z